This elementary school English spelling quiz takes a further look at unstressed vowels. In the first Unstressed Vowels quiz, you will have learned about the 'schwa' sound which causes so much difficulty with English spelling. With very few exceptions, every polysyllabic word in English is pronounced with at least one schwa sound. This is why learning to spell takes quite a bit of practice.
